New Star Wars Transformers on display at the Celebration IV

Transformers News: New Star Wars Transformers on display at the Celebration IV

Friday, May 25th, 2007 10:52AM CDT

Categories: Toy News, Events
Posted by: Seibertron   Views: 14,208

Topic Options: View Discussion · Sign in or Join to reply

The popular Star Wars fan website RebelScum.com has recently posted their coverage of Celebration IV Star Wars event in Los Angeles.

"It's a celebration of galactic proportions going down in downtown Los Angeles from May 24th through May28th. We've got almost the entire Rebelscum team on hand to provide the best possible coverage you'll find anywhere - from exclusive collectibles to collector panels, it's gonna be a blast! Stay tuned to this very page for constant updates throughout the show."

RebelScum.com has posted some pictures of the upcoming Star Wars Transformers figures which you can view at http://www.rebelscum.com/c4/c4transformers/.

Some of the upcoming Star Wars Transformers figures pictured are:
  • Galactic Showdown set featuring Darth Vader (Tie Fighter) versus Obi-Wan Kenobi (Jedi Starfighter) which is a Wal-Mart Exclusive

  • Commander Cody (Turbo Tank)

  • AT-AT Driver (AT-AT)

  • Luke Skywalker (Snowspeeder)

  • Darth Vader (Death Star)
